#DA2561 Color
#DA2561 is rgb(218, 37, 97) in RGB, hsl(340, 71%, 50%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 83%, 56%, 15%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Cerise (#DE3163),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 2.91.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#DA2561 Channel Values
How #DA2561 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 218 · G 37 · B 97 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 340° · S 71% · L 50%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 340° · S 83% · V 85%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 83% · Y 56% · K 15%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 4.75:1 vs white · 4.42: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#DA2561 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#DA2561?
#DA2561 is a mid-tone pink — rgb(218, 37, 97) in RGB and hsl(340, 71%, 50%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Cerise (#DE3163),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 2.91.
What is the RGB value of #DA2561?
#DA2561 is rgb(218, 37, 97) — red 218, green 37, and blue 97 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#DA2561?
#DA2561 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 83%, 56%, 15%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#DA2561 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#DA2561 scores 4.75:1 against white and 4.42: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#DA2561 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#DA2561 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is crimson (#DC143C) at a CIE76 distance of 21.37, which is visibly different.
